The George W. Bush Presidential Center is selling an ornament that features 43’s own painting of a cardinal perched on a branch.

Bush painted the bird as a gift for former Ambassador Warren Tichenor, and his wife decided it looked Christmas-y.

(WATCH: George W. Bush paints Jay Leno's portrait)

“Laura liked the bright red on the cardinal and the green of the foliage and chose my painting, for which I am grateful, for the Christmas card and the ornament,” the former president says in a video posted online. “I’m flattered. I hope my painting meets expectations.”

Earlier this week, Bush chatted about his painting hobby on “The Tonight Show.”
